A thriller
By Anthony L. Cuaycong
Kevin Durant gave it all he had. A trip to the Eastern Conference Finals was in the offing, and — with fellow All-Stars Kyrie Irving sidelined and James Harden hobbled due to injury — he figured to “keep the ball in my hands a little bit more.” Not that the Nets had any choice going into yesterday’s do-or-die affair. With all the chips on the table, they were compelled to rely on the finest scorer in National Basketball Association history as often as they could. Which, under head coach Steve Nash, meant giving him little rest and handing him the reins often early, and just about every single time in the crunch.
